Originally Posted by Wodin LSE are Large Shield Extender - the better the extender, the better your tank will be. Your goal here is to increase the recharge rate of your shields such that at peak recharge(35% shields) you're getting back enough HP to tank anything.
The three rat-specific active hardeners means that you're looking at whatever you're fighting(say it's Amarr). That would be 2xPhoton Hardening Field and one Thermal Barrier or whatever they're called. Serpentis would be 2xKinetic Absorbtion and one Thermal Barrier, etc. Shields -> Shield Hardeners -> look for the ones that cost cap to run. Since you already have a cap recharge rig on your Drake, you can probably run at least one Invulnerability field just fine.
SPR are Shield Power Relay(drastically increase shield recharge rate at the cost of lowered cap recharge, but you're not using your cap for anything).
BCS are Ballistic Control System(missile damage mods) |
